Tooth sensitivity occurs when the underlying layer of your teeth, called dentin, ends up being subjected. This typically happens when your enamel wears down or when your periodontals recede. The dentin contains microscopic tubules that lead directly to the switchboard of your tooth. When these tubules are subjected to temperature adjustments, pleasant or acidic foods, or even air, you experience that sharp, awkward sensation that makes you wince.

Recognizing the Root Causes of Tooth Sensitivity
Prior to you can properly take care of tooth level of sensitivity throughout stormy period, you need to understand what creates it in the first place. Enamel erosion places as one of the key wrongdoers. Your enamel works as the safety outer covering of your teeth, however it can progressively wear off as a result of acidic foods and drinks, aggressive brushing, or teeth grinding.
Gum tissue economic crisis stands for one more common cause. When your gum tissues draw back from your teeth, they subject the root surfaces, which do not have the safety enamel covering. This condition can arise from periodontal disease, harsh cleaning methods, or just genetic factors. Lots of citizens that delight in outdoor tasks along Seminole's beaches could clinch their teeth against the wind or cold water, potentially contributing to gum stress with time.
Dental caries, even in its beginning, can trigger level of sensitivity. Tooth cavities produce openings that allow stimuli to get to the nerve much more conveniently. Practical Strategies for Managing Sensitivity During Humid Months
Taking care of tooth sensitivity throughout Seminole's wet period needs a complex technique that addresses both prompt discomfort and long-lasting protection. Begin by evaluating your everyday oral hygiene regimen. Switch to a soft-bristled tooth brush if you haven't already, and make use of gentle circular activities rather than hostile back-and-forth scrubbing up. Lots of people comb too hard without recognizing it, progressively deteriorating enamel and bothersome periodontal tissue.
Desensitizing tooth paste can give significant alleviation when made use of consistently. These specialized formulas have compounds that help block the tubules in your dentin, lowering the transmission of sensations to the nerve. Apply the tooth paste as routed, and consider leaving a small amount on especially delicate locations for a couple of minutes before rinsing. Results normally show up after numerous days of regular use.
Focus on your diet regimen throughout the moist months. Restriction acidic foods and drinks such as citrus fruits, tomatoes, pickled items, and sodas. When you do consume these products, rinse your mouth with water afterward, however wait a minimum of half an hour prior to cleaning to avoid scrubbing acid into your enamel. The waiting period permits your saliva to naturally remineralize your teeth.
Consider using a fluoride mouth wash daily to reinforce your enamel. Fluoride aids restore damaged enamel and can decrease sensitivity gradually. You can discover these rinses at any type of pharmacy in Seminole, from the Walgreens on Seminole Boulevard to the CVS near Walsingham Road.

Identifying When to Seek Immediate Care
While many tooth sensitivity can be handled with precautionary treatment and home therapies, specific symptoms call for timely professional attention. Sharp, extreme pain that lasts more than a couple of seconds after exposure to a trigger could suggest a broken tooth or deep degeneration. Level of sensitivity concentrated in one details tooth instead of multiple teeth usually indicates an issue that requires diagnosis and treatment.
If you notice swelling, relentless foul breath, or bleeding gum tissues along with level of sensitivity, these symptoms could indicate gum tissue disease or infection.
